CaptureSAGINAW TOWNSHIP, MI Saginaw Medical Federal Credit Union collected donations valued at more than $1,400 for the Child Abuse and Neglect Council of Saginaw County. The credit union celebrated International Credit Union Day throughout October by "Uniting for Good" with the CAN Council, which helps prevent child abuse and neglect through education, awareness, intervention and advocacy programs. Money, school supplies, craft supplies, games, toys, snacks and cleaning supplies were donated at Saginaw Medical Federal Credit Union locations at 4550 State in Saginaw Township and 1430 N. Michigan in Saginaw. Saginaw Medical Federal Credit Union was chartered in 1971 to serve the health care community and their families. The credit union has over 12,000 members and $120 million in assets.
